HomeMy WebLinkAboutRES NO 020-06 RESOLUTION NO. 020-06 A RESOLUTION FINDING THE PURCHASE OF CERTAIN REAL PROPERTY TO BE EXEMPT FROM THE CALIFORNIA ENVIRONMENTAL QUALITY ACT. WHEREAS, the Fruitvale Union School District ("the District") owns a one-acre parcel of property adjacent to Endeavor School ("the Property") which they do not need for school use; and WHEREAS, the location of the Property is an ideal location for a fire station; and WHEREAS, on December 13, 2005, the District's Board of Trustees adopted Resolution #0506-07 declaring its "Intention to Sell Real Property to Another Public Agency"; and WHEREAS, that resolution contains the legal description of the Property and sets forth the District's intention to sell the Property to the City of Bakersfield ("City"), providing that certain conditions are met; and WHEREAS, City intends to meet those conditions; and WHEREAS, pursuant to California law, that resolution was published once a week for three weeks; and WHEREAS, in accordance with Section 2.28.120, the Planning Director has found the acquisition of the Property to be consistent with the General Plan; and WHEREAS, City staff has made the determination that acquiring the property is exempt from the California Environmental Quality Act ("CEQA") in that there is no potential for the acquisition to have a significant impact on the environment (14 California Code of Regulations section 15061 (b )(3) - General Rule). N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the Council of the City of Bakersfield as follows: 1. The above recitals and findings are true and correct and are incorporated herein by reference; and 2. The purchase of the Property is exempt from the California Environmental Quality Act, in that there is no potential for any significant impact on the environment (14 California Code of Regulations 15061 (b)(3) - General Rule; and 3.
